Physical pendulum – rodlike

Experiment no.: 5.1.602
Physika­lisches Pendel – stabförmig
A rod-shaped pendulum has a different period of oscillation than a wire pendulum, even with small deflections, because its mass is not only at the end of the pendulum. This can be used to demonstrate Steiner's theorem.
